STREAMZ headphones is the first Voice Controlled Headset with hi-res Music Player

STREAMZ headphones is the first smart headset that comes with Voice Controlled technology, features more than wonderful experience, there is built-in music player Hi-Res and SD card for storage without the need to connect with other devices.

STREAMZ have HD quality sound with smart features, have Wi-Fi, a 1.6 GHz Quad-core Android processor and small display, can be controlled through voice commands without need to touch the controls.

STREAMZ headphones All-In-One

The headphones can also play music from popular applications such as Spotify, Pandora and Tidal through Wi-Fi connection, which allows to connect to any device and music player. This headset has been developed over 4 years.

Featuring Voxxi Voice Control technology designed to act like a smartphone but dedicated more to music. The STREAMZ app for Android and IOS will be aviliable to control all the features of STREAMZ from one location and customize them as you prefer. The application contains an EQ mixer to adjust the sound of the music that suits you.

STREAMZ headphones Specs

STREAMZ features a quad-core Cortex A5 1.6ghz processor with Android system, plus a 128 x 128 pixel OLED display, 1GB RAM and 4GB internal storage also, you can increase storage space on SD cards up to 256GB.

The headset uses Wi-Fi to connect to other devices instead of Bluetooth to provide higher sound quality with precise synchronization, supports many audio file formats “wav, flac, ogg, apple aiff HD, mp3, aac, m4a, SD Format” Operates for 6 hours continuously at one charge time.

Here are some other important specs and details:

  • frequency range: 20hz-20khz
  • Dynamic Range: 115DB
  • connection: Wi-Fi, 3.5mm cable, Bluetooth 4.0 APTX
  • Dynamic speaker size: 5 mm
  • Contains an application to control all musical details to improve the user experience and create music lists from multiple sources and devices.
  • It has a 3.5 mm input / output port and an internal microphone
  • Contains an internal DAC signal adapter with ESS technology and Saber Es9023 cpu at 96kHz-16bit
  • Contains several control buttons on the left and right side of the headset

The STREAMZ V9 is expected to be launched at the beginning of next September at $ 449 in white / black colors, and supports some simple voice commands to play apps and stream music.
